Armadillos K-O Raiders, 10-0
|
The home team gave the crowd at Armadillos Park something to cheer about.
Amarillo Armadillos starter Franklin Lucero was in the groove. He led his team to a win over the Reno Raiders, 10-0. Lucero yielded no runs over 5.2 innings to notch the win. He scattered 5 hits, walked 2, and struck out 2. His record improves to 9-4.
The Armadillos got a big hit from third baseman Tyler Pate. Facing Reno pitcher Willie Aragon in the bottom of the seventh, Pate pounded a grand slam home run to left-center. His 18th home run of the season put the Armadillos ahead, 8-0.
Said losing manager Rod Cirilo: "It's very easy to sit in an ivory tower and critique the pitching, but the bottom line is we need to score runs."
The 4th-place Raiders have dropped 4 straight games.
